President Obama wants, quite reasonably, to "reset" relations with
Russia. He also said, quite reasonably, he would "go through the
federal budget line by line, programs that don't work, we cut."
Our relations with Colombia also need to be reset. "Plan Colombia,"
which was supposedly going to cut the flow of Colombian cocaine into
the U.S., doesn't work, neither to reduce the flow of illegal drugs,
nor to promote human rights, democracy and the rule of law in
Colombia. Since Plan Colombia doesn't work, it should be cut.
